Definition of Statfarad

Statfarad is a non-standard unit of capacitance used primarily in the Gaussian system of units. It represents the capacitance of a capacitor that holds one statcoulomb of electric charge at a potential difference of one statvolt. Although not commonly used in modern scientific practices, understanding statfarad is crucial for interpreting older scientific literature and contexts where the Gaussian cgs (centimeter-gram-second) system is applied. Definition of Picofarad

Picofarad is a unit of capacitance equal to one trillionth (10^-12) of a farad, the SI unit of capacitance. It is commonly used in electronics and electrical engineering to measure the capacitance of small capacitors. The use of picofarads is prevalent due to the convenience it offers when dealing with the typically small capacitance values found in circuits. This unit is vital for designing and analyzing electronic circuits, particularly in radiofrequency (RF) and high-frequency applications, where capacitors with such small values play critical roles in tuning and filtering signals.
